## Runbook — Wrenlock WS reconnect loop

Symptom: clients reconnect in a tight loop after a gateway restart. Cause: stale session tokens rejected faster than the client backoff ramps. Fix: flush the session cache, then roll gateway pods one at a time. Do not restart all pods at once — that triggers the stampede again. Verify reconnect rates drop below baseline. The gateway runs with these values.

service settings:
PRAIX_LOG_LEVEL=error
PRAIX_METRICS_HOST=metrics.praix.qorvelcorp.corp
PRAIX_POOL_SIZE=16

## Approvals: Laundry-Locker Access Flow

Welcome aboard! Any change to the locker access flow in SudsPoint (QR handoff, pickup codes, courtesy overrides) needs a formal approval before merge. Why? Because a bad release once locked forty machines in the Harwick Commons building for a weekend. Open a change ticket, tag it access-flow, attach your test evidence, and wait for sign-off — no self-approvals, even for typo fixes. Reviews usually turn around within a day. The final sign-off always comes from one person.

named custodian: Belius Casath Ulaix Sorius

Quarterly Planning Note — Reseller Programme

For sales leads: the Corvane reseller programme enters phase two next quarter. Tier thresholds are being simplified to three bands, and margin accelerators will apply to partners exceeding volume targets on the Lanthis range. Onboarding for the Westmere cohort begins in week four. Keep commitments conservative until contracts are countersigned. The confidential summary of related business plans appears directly below.

confidential, kagup-bafog: Fraaxax Group is in early talks to buy Soroxox Group for about $343.8 million. The Olidor launch date is June 14, and nothing goes to the press before then. Legal wants the Aldmirek Logistics term sheet signed before July 23.